Lately, I have noticed on Pinterest there a many cookie recipes that include cream cheese as one of the ingredients.
I’ve made cookies with pudding mix in the dough and I’ve made cookies with cake mix in the dough. So when I saw so many recipes using a combination of cream cheese and butter, I knew I had to give it a try.
I’m always willing to try something new, especially when it’s a new ingredient in my cookie recipe!
The cream cheese makes the cookies tender and moist, just like a soft batch cookie. The cookie has slight crisp edges with a slightly chewy middle. I really like the way this cookie came out. The only thing I don’t like is having to let the cookie dough rest in the fridge for a of couple hours prior to baking.

- ¼ cup cream cheese, softened
- 1 stick butter, softened
- ½ cup granulated sugar
- ½ cup light brown sugar, packed
- 1 large egg, at room temperature
- 2¼ teaspoons vanilla extract
- 2¼ c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 2 teaspoon cornstarch
- ⅛ teaspoon salt
- 1 cup chocolate chips
- ½ cup M&M's
- Beat butter, cream cheese and sugar until combined {I use my stand mixer for these}.
- Add egg and vanilla and beat until combined.
- In a large bowl combine flour, baking soda, cornstarch, and salt. Stir ingredients.
- With a large spoon add 2 spoonfuls of the flour mixture to the sugar mixture and continue with this until all the flour mixture is incorporated into the sugar mixture.
- Add the chocolate chips and the M&M's and fold in by hand.
- Place plastic wrap over the cookie dough and place in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ours, up to 3 days.
- ---After dough has chilled---
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
- Place parchment paper or a silpat mat on a cookie sheet.
- Allow dough to soften just until a cookie scoop can be used.
- Using a small cookie scoop place mounds of dough onto cookie sheet. Do not crowd.
- Bake for 8 to 10 minutes depending upon your oven. Cookies should be just turning brown at the edges but still look soft in the center.
- Remove cookies from oven and allow to cool on the cookie sheet for 10 minutes prior to moving cookies to a cooking rack.
